#c71852 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#c71852 is composed of 78% red, 9.4% green and 32.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 87.9% magenta, 58.8% yellow and 22% black. It has a hue angle of 340.1 degrees, a saturation of 78.5% and a lightness of 43.7%. #c71852 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ff30a4 with #8f0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0066.

Shades and Tints of #c71852

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060103 is the darkest color, while #fef4f7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#c71852

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#716e6f is the less saturated color, while #d8074c is the most saturated one.
